City of Berkeley Names February 5th Al Young Day
Join the Jazzschool as we congratulate poet Al Young Tuesday February 5th as the City of Berkeley proclaim February 5th as Al Young Day. Congratulations Al!
In celebration of his literary and cultural contributions to the community and to continue honoring its creative artists (past honorees include former U.S. poet laureate Robert Hass and eco-feminist author Susan Griffin). the City of Berkeley and its City Council will proclaim Tuesday, February 5, 2013 as AL YOUNG DAY.
Official proclamation will take place between 7pm and 7:30 pm at City Hall, 2180 Milvia Street, Berkeley, CA 94704.
To honor Al Young Day, poet-broadcaster Jack Foley interviewed Al Young extensively for “Cover to Cover,” his Wednesday afternoon KPFA radio program devoted to authors and literary culture. Broadcast date: February 6, 3 pm PST. Listen at www.kpfa.org
